1. Launching a Service-Based Business for Passive Income
Starting a service-based business online requires minimal upfront investment. Think about the skills you already possess. Are you a writer, editor, graphic designer, social media manager, web developer, or virtual assistant? These skills are highly sought after and can be monetized quickly. Platforms like Upwork, Fiverr, and LinkedIn provide a direct connection to clients seeking your specific expertise. The key is to build a compelling profile showcasing your skills and experience. Offer competitive rates initially to attract clients and build positive reviews. As you establish a reputation, you can gradually increase your rates.
The beauty of a service-based business is its scalability. You can start solo and gradually build a team of freelancers as demand increases. This allows you to take on more projects without significantly increasing your workload. Over time, you can systemize your processes, create templates, and even develop training materials to streamline your service delivery. Focus on building strong relationships with your clients. Repeat business and referrals are crucial for long-term success. Furthermore think about packaging your services and charging ongoing monthly retainers. This turns a one-off service engagement into predictable, recurring revenue streams, enabling you to build passive income.
For example, if you’re a skilled writer, you could offer blog writing services to businesses. By creating a system for researching keywords, outlining content, and writing compelling articles, you can produce a high volume of content efficiently. You could also offer editing and proofreading services, which require minimal upfront investment in tools or software. Start by targeting a niche market where you have existing knowledge or expertise. This will allow you to position yourself as a specialist and attract higher-paying clients.

2. Creating and Selling Digital Products for Financial Freedom
Digital products offer significant advantages for entrepreneurs on a tight budget. Unlike physical products, they have virtually no production or inventory costs. Once created, a digital product can be sold repeatedly without requiring additional resources. Examples of popular digital products include eBooks, online courses, templates, software, and digital art. The key is to identify a problem or need in the market and create a digital product that provides a valuable solution.
Platforms like Teachable, Gumroad, and Etsy provide easy-to-use tools for creating and selling digital products. Teachable is ideal for creating and selling online courses, while Gumroad is a simpler platform for selling eBooks, templates, and other digital downloads. Etsy is a great option for selling digital art, printables, and other creative products. Before creating your digital product, conduct thorough market research to validate your idea. Identify your target audience and understand their pain points. Create a product that directly addresses these pain points and offers a clear benefit.
Marketing your digital product is crucial for success. Utilize social media, email marketing, and content marketing to reach your target audience. Create valuable content that demonstrates your expertise and attracts potential customers. Offer free samples or lead magnets to generate leads and build your email list. Consider using paid advertising on platforms like Facebook and Instagram to reach a wider audience. Continually monitor your sales and marketing data to optimize your strategies and improve your results. It can be a journey towards true financial freedom.

3. Leveraging Affiliate Marketing for Wealth Building
Affiliate marketing is a powerful way to generate income online without creating your own products. As an affiliate, you promote other companies’ products or services and earn a commission on each sale made through your unique affiliate link. This eliminates the need for product development, inventory management, and customer service. The key to success in affiliate marketing is to choose products that align with your niche and your audience’s interests.
Start by identifying affiliate programs that offer attractive commission rates and align with your niche. Amazon Associates is a popular option, but there are many other affiliate programs available through platforms like Commission Junction, ShareASale, and Awin. Create valuable content that promotes the products or services you’re affiliating with. This could include blog posts, product reviews, tutorials, or comparison articles. Optimize your content for search engines to attract organic traffic. Use social media and email marketing to promote your content and drive traffic to your affiliate links.
Transparency is crucial in affiliate marketing. Always disclose that you are an affiliate and that you earn a commission on sales made through your links. This builds trust with your audience and protects you from legal issues. Focus on providing genuine value to your audience, rather than simply promoting products for the sake of earning commissions. Recommend products that you genuinely believe in and that will benefit your audience. Consider using paid advertising to amplify your reach and drive more traffic to your affiliate links. Remember that wealth building is a marathon, so it’s important to build trust and credibility with your audience over time.
